Force Reflection Accuracy

from class:

Haptic Interfaces and Telerobotics

Definition

Force reflection accuracy refers to the degree to which a telerobotic system can accurately reproduce the forces experienced by a remote environment at the operator's end. High force reflection accuracy is crucial for providing realistic feedback, enabling operators to sense and respond to the physical interactions they would encounter if they were present in the remote environment. This concept is significantly influenced by time delay compensation techniques, which help mitigate the effects of latency in communication between the operator and the robot.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Force reflection accuracy is vital for tasks requiring precision, such as surgery or delicate assembly work, where any discrepancies can lead to errors.
  2. Latency in communication can significantly degrade force reflection accuracy, making time delay compensation techniques essential for optimal performance.
  3. Adaptive algorithms can enhance force reflection accuracy by adjusting feedback based on real-time performance metrics and operator responses.
  4. High fidelity in force reflection is crucial for maintaining an operator's situational awareness and confidence when performing remote operations.
  5. Improvements in force reflection accuracy can lead to better user satisfaction and trust in telerobotic systems, especially in critical applications.

Review Questions

  • How does force reflection accuracy impact the effectiveness of telerobotic systems in precision tasks?
    • Force reflection accuracy directly impacts the effectiveness of telerobotic systems by ensuring that operators receive realistic feedback about their interactions with the remote environment. In precision tasks like surgery or delicate assembly, accurate force feedback is crucial for making informed decisions and executing fine motor skills. Without high force reflection accuracy, operators may struggle to gauge their actions properly, potentially leading to mistakes or mishaps.
  • Discuss how time delay compensation techniques can enhance force reflection accuracy in telerobotic systems.
    • Time delay compensation techniques are critical in enhancing force reflection accuracy by addressing the latency that occurs during data transmission between the operator and the robot. By predicting and compensating for delays, these techniques ensure that operators receive timely feedback that closely matches their physical interactions with the remote environment. This synchronization helps maintain a more immersive and responsive experience, allowing operators to feel as if they are truly engaging with the task at hand.
  • Evaluate the significance of maintaining high force reflection accuracy in the context of advancing telerobotic applications in healthcare.
    • Maintaining high force reflection accuracy is particularly significant as telerobotic applications expand in healthcare settings, such as remote surgeries and rehabilitation. Accurate force feedback allows surgeons to operate with precision even from a distance, mimicking the tactile sensations they would feel if performing the procedure directly. This level of accuracy not only enhances patient safety and outcomes but also fosters greater trust among healthcare professionals in utilizing telerobotic systems, thus encouraging wider adoption of these technologies in critical medical scenarios.
